Pygeum Bark Africanum P E Sales Market Outlook
The global market for Pygeum Bark Africanum P E is projected to reach approximately USD 1.2 billion by 2035,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of around 7.5% during the forecast period from 2025 to 2035. This growth is largely driven by the increasing consumer awareness regarding natural health products, alongside the rising prevalence of prostate-related health issues which have led to a surge in demand for dietary supplements containing Pygeum Bark Africanum. Additionally, the expansion of the herbal medicine market and the growing inclination towards preventive healthcare measures are anticipated to further bolster the market’s growth. E-commerce platforms are becoming a vital distribution channel, helping to reach a broader audience and enhancing sales on a global scale. Moreover, the versatility of Pygeum Bark Africanum in various applications such as nutritional supplements, pharmaceuticals, and cosmetics is likely to create significant opportunities for market expansion.

Pharmaceuticals :
The pharmaceuticals segment is increasingly recognizing the therapeutic potential of Pygeum Bark Africanum, particularly in treating benign prostatic hyperplasia (BPH) and other prostate-related conditions. Clinical studies showcasing the efficacy of Pygeum extracts in alleviating symptoms associated with BPH have led to its incorporation into various pharmaceutical formulations. The increasing shift towards natural remedies in the pharmaceutical industry is creating a favorable environment for Pygeum Bark’s integration into mainstream medicine. Moreover, regulatory approvals and the backing of scientific research are likely to drive the adoption of Pygeum bark in pharmaceutical products, further expanding its market presence.

By Region
The North American region is a key player in the Pygeum Bark Africanum market, accounting for approximately 35% of the global share due to the well-established dietary supplement industry and high consumer awareness regarding men's health issues. The demand for natural and herbal remedies among the aging population further supports the growth of this market segment. Additionally, the increasing prevalence of prostate disorders in the United States highlights the necessity for effective solutions, thus driving the popularity of supplements containing Pygeum Bark. The market is expected to grow at a CAGR of 6.8% during the forecast period, reflecting a robust expansion of health-oriented consumer products in the region.
In Europe, the Pygeum Bark Africanum market is projected to grow steadily, driven by the increasing trend of natural health products and a rising focus on preventive healthcare. The European market is characterized by stringent regulations regarding health claims and product safety, which encourages the development of high-quality Pygeum Bark products. This region accounts for about 30% of the global market share, with countries like Germany and France leading the demand due to their established supplement industries. The growing interest in herbal medicine and complementary therapies among European consumers is likely to propel the market's growth over the coming years. Meanwhile, the Asia Pacific region is expected to witness significant growth, with a CAGR of 8.2%, as consumer awareness regarding herbal health solutions continues to rise, particularly in countries like India and China.

Another significant concern is the potential environmental impact and sustainability of harvesting Pygeum Bark Africanum. Overharvesting of the bark could threaten the species and impact its availability in the market. As sustainability becomes a key focus for consumers, brands must take proactive measures to ensure responsible sourcing and promote conservation efforts. Failing to address these environmental concerns could lead to reputational damage and loss of consumer loyalty, particularly among eco-conscious buyers. Moreover, fluctuations in the raw material supply chain due to geopolitical factors may result in price volatility, which could affect manufacturers' profit margins and the overall pricing of Pygeum Bark products.
